Output bb87802501c8367e569d54976ea0f5b94720f1fc9cb3e07acd6667dd3dde899d:1

value
9385971857
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ac167c341a3a0475c3ce0186c41344f14da0bcb5854c834f35ddfd83ab77bf2a
address
tb1p4st8cdq68gz8ts7wqxrvgy6y79x6p094s4xgxne4mh7c82mhhu4qpafryh
transaction
bb87802501c8367e569d54976ea0f5b94720f1fc9cb3e07acd6667dd3dde899d
confirmations
80352
spent
true